Subject: Sure--- but I would pay attention to the rules surrounding "listed property"..........



Oskaloosa, Iowa 52577

A portion of a personal auto.........or an auto that can be used personally as compared to "obviously business only"...........is deductible for business..........but...........

you have to prove the business portion.

Code Section 280F defines listed property.......which includes property used for entertainment........and Section 274(d) provides rules for substantiation of the business use thereof.

So.........read Code section 274 especially, and decide whether or not you want to do the documentation necessary to avoid an "accuracy-related penalty"..........which most likely would be assessed in addition to the additional income taxes when/if it gets thrown out.
